The Origins of Nescafé Dolce Gusto
Released in 2006, Nescafé Dolce Gusto is a product of Nestlé, which has a long-standing history in the coffee industry. The brand was developed to cater to the growing demand for high-quality, quick-to-prepare coffee options that didn't require the know-how usually connected with barista-quality drinks. The system utilizes coffee capsules-- each created with ingenious innovation-- to make sure constant flavor and quality.

As the world ends up being progressively eco-conscious, the effect of single-use coffee capsules is a legitimate issue. Nescafé has made strides in this area by developing recyclable capsules, but consumers ought to still be conscious of their waste practices.
